Surya Roshni Limited has submitted its Annual Secretarial Compliance Report for the financial year ended March 31, 2026, as required under SEBI Regulation 24A. The secretarial audit was conducted by Anjali Yadav & Associates, Company Secretaries. The report indicates that the company largely complied with applicable SEBI regulations and secretarial standards. However, two regulatory violations were noted in Annexure A — both related to delays in appointing Independent Directors beyond the mandated 3-month window under Regulation 17(1)(E) of SEBI LODR. The first violation involved a 56-day delay during Q1 FY26 (June 2025 quarter), resulting in a fine of ₹2,80,000. The second involved a 16-day delay during Q2 FY26 (September 2025 quarter), resulting in a fine of ₹80,000. Both fines were paid by the company, and waiver applications were submitted to BSE and NSE. No other non-compliance was observed.
The company faced regulatory fines totaling ₹3,60,000 for delayed appointments of independent directors. The matter appears to have been resolved with fines paid and waivers sought. Overall, the compliance report is largely clean with no major red flags for shareholders.
